Hart Components

Client:
Hart Components
Market:
Industrial, Manufacturing
Location:
Taylor, Texas

Project Details

Hart Components is a Texas-based supplier of residential and commercial building materials. Established as J.P. Hart Lumber over 75 years ago, the company built a new facility in Taylor, Texas to better serve their customers across the region.

The project consists of a new 43,300 square-foot warehouse and office building and a 80,000 square-foot assembly building situated on a 28-acre site. The site also includes surface parking lots, laydown and storage yards, and drainage improvements. In addition, a railroad stop off and connection to the adjacent main railroad line was originally designed as part of the project, but was not constructed due to cost concerns.

WGI provided civil engineering and site development permitting services for the project, which was completed in 2019. WGI’s civil service provided on the project included site planning, site utilities, site drainage, submitting applications, permitting, and construction administration.
